Argyle cut a 300-meter cable into two pieces. One piece was 15m longer than twice the length of the other. Find the length of the longer piece.

205 m

let x be the length of one piece then the other piece is 2x + 15

The sum of the 2 pieces equals 300 m , hence

x + 2x + 15 = 300

3x + 15 = 300 ( subtract 15 from both sides )

3x = 285 ( divide both sides by 3 )

x = 95

length of longer piece = (2 × 95 ) + 15 = 190 + 15 = 205 m
